Background: The study explores the intricate anatomy of the proximal femur in the Indian
population, emphasizing its significance in clinical, forensic, and orthopaedic contexts. Utilizing
Gray's Anatomy and relevant literature, the study positions femoral anatomy as crucial for clinicians
and researchers. Existing studies on femur length reconstruction contribute to forensic applications,
while orthopaedic research underscores the importance of anatomical measurements in surgical
interventions.
